'Snuff' by Chuck Palahniuk

'Snuff' is classic Chuck Palahniuk. It is the story of a suicidal porn queen who wants to leave this world by setting the world record for having the most lovers at one time on camera, which she expects to die from.

The story is told by 4 people: the female personal assistant to the porn queen, a participant who is a washed up TV star trying to make a comeback, a participant and washed up porn star who may or may not be the father of the porn queen's child that was given up for adoption 20 years ago, and a participant who believes that he is the porn queen's child.

I literally could not put this book down. I read it in one sitting. It was both hilarious and grotesque, but it was truly entertaining. Chuck Palahniuk has done it again. I rank this book his third best, behind 'Choke' and 'Fight Club'. After his last books 'Haunted' and 'Rant', I expected 'Snuff' to disappoint. I was dead wrong. He's definitely still got it.

If you like Palahniuk, you will love 'Snuff'. And if you don't like Palahniuk, then 'Snuff' will probably make you vomit.
